Comment (by westi):

 Replying to [comment:5 SergeyBiryukov]:
 > Replying to [comment:4 westi]:
 > > We should fix where this is called.
 >
 > I don't see any warnings in core about this (checked on PHP 5.2.14 and
 5.3.3). I've briefly reviewed all calls to `number_format_i18n()`, and
 didn't find anything strange. I guess the purpose of this change is to
 avoid the warning if a wrong parameter is passed by a plugin or a theme.

 I don't think we should "hide" warning generated by plugin/theme bugs.
